HARRIS Boric Acid Roach and Silverfish Killer Powder w/Lure for Insects (16oz)








Key features
- •Long Lasting - Continues to kill roaches, palmetto bugs, water bugs and silverfish for weeks after application as long as it's kept dry
- •Fast Acting - Insects coming into contact with the powder will die within 72 hours after initial contact
- •Easy Application - The puffer with extended straw makes application quick and simple for difficult to reach areas
- •Contains Irresistible Lure - Harris food grade lure attracts roaches from their hiding places
- •EPA Registered - Made in the USA & Registered with the Environmental Protection Agency (No. 3-10) for use in homes with people and pets

Works really well, but slowly
talonstriker✓ Verified Purchase•August 24, 2017
Works like a charm,but I didn't follow the instructions as others have suggested. Instead of dusting it all over the place, I just used to squirt some on cockroaches I saw scurry past.
I didn't see any immediate affects, but after 2 weeks or so I can clearly see the results in less roach poop and generally being difficult find roaches even when food is being left out.
I recommend using this in combination with https://www.amazon.com/Advion-Syngenta-Cockroach-Bait-Tubes/dp/B002Y2GNVM/ref=sr_1_2?ie=UTF8&qid=1503803583&sr=8-2. The syngenta is like candy to the roaches but doesn't seem to actually kill any of them. I used them to bait the roaches and squirted the ones that came out to eat it with Boric Acid.
